diff options
| author | Wout Gevaert <[email protected]> | 2022-11-08 18:07:18 +0100 |
|---|---|---|
| committer | John MacFarlane <[email protected]> | 2022-11-11 10:12:07 -0800 |
| commit | 0b003de6f1d6569184cf12d826f0ea69da2b2dff (patch) | |
| tree | 2e1c45f222b25b55b9a6b0b3fec98d2af85b62c4 /test/tables.mediawiki | |
| parent | c5dbedcd4edf20ae409f3de71bcebaac9a22a7fc (diff) | |
Change the Mediawiki writer to use the 'new' table structure
Now MediaWiki tables can use colspan and rowspan :D
Diffstat (limited to 'test/tables.mediawiki')
| -rw-r--r-- | test/tables.mediawiki | 191 |
1 files changed, 99 insertions, 92 deletions
diff --git a/test/tables.mediawiki b/test/tables.mediawiki index ccf75f975..e8fe567aa 100644 --- a/test/tables.mediawiki +++ b/test/tables.mediawiki @@ -1,145 +1,152 @@ Simple table with caption: -{| +{| class="wikitable" |+ Demonstration of simple table syntax. -!align="right"| Right -! Left -!align="center"| Center +|- +! style="text-align: right;"| Right +! style="text-align: left;"| Left +! style="text-align: center;"| Center ! Default |- -|align="right"| 12 -| 12 -|align="center"| 12 +| style="text-align: right;"| 12 +| style="text-align: left;"| 12 +| style="text-align: center;"| 12 | 12 |- -|align="right"| 123 -| 123 -|align="center"| 123 +| style="text-align: right;"| 123 +| style="text-align: left;"| 123 +| style="text-align: center;"| 123 | 123 |- -|align="right"| 1 -| 1 -|align="center"| 1 +| style="text-align: right;"| 1 +| style="text-align: left;"| 1 +| style="text-align: center;"| 1 | 1 |} Simple table without caption: -{| -!align="right"| Right -! Left -!align="center"| Center +{| class="wikitable" +|- +! style="text-align: right;"| Right +! style="text-align: left;"| Left +! style="text-align: center;"| Center ! Default |- -|align="right"| 12 -| 12 -|align="center"| 12 +| style="text-align: right;"| 12 +| style="text-align: left;"| 12 +| style="text-align: center;"| 12 | 12 |- -|align="right"| 123 -| 123 -|align="center"| 123 +| style="text-align: right;"| 123 +| style="text-align: left;"| 123 +| style="text-align: center;"| 123 | 123 |- -|align="right"| 1 -| 1 -|align="center"| 1 +| style="text-align: right;"| 1 +| style="text-align: left;"| 1 +| style="text-align: center;"| 1 | 1 |} Simple table indented two spaces: -{| +{| class="wikitable" |+ Demonstration of simple table syntax. -!align="right"| Right -! Left -!align="center"| Center +|- +! style="text-align: right;"| Right +! style="text-align: left;"| Left +! style="text-align: center;"| Center ! Default |- -|align="right"| 12 -| 12 -|align="center"| 12 +| style="text-align: right;"| 12 +| style="text-align: left;"| 12 +| style="text-align: center;"| 12 | 12 |- -|align="right"| 123 -| 123 -|align="center"| 123 +| style="text-align: right;"| 123 +| style="text-align: left;"| 123 +| style="text-align: center;"| 123 | 123 |- -|align="right"| 1 -| 1 -|align="center"| 1 +| style="text-align: right;"| 1 +| style="text-align: left;"| 1 +| style="text-align: center;"| 1 | 1 |} Multiline table with caption: -{| +{| class="wikitable" |+ Here’s the caption. It may span multiple lines. -!align="center" width="15%"| Centered Header -!width="13%"| Left Aligned -!align="right" width="16%"| Right Aligned -!width="35%"| Default aligned -|- -|align="center"| First -| row -|align="right"| 12.0 -| Example of a row that spans multiple lines. |- -|align="center"| Second -| row -|align="right"| 5.0 -| Here’s another one. Note the blank line between rows. +! style="text-align: center;"| Centered Header +! style="text-align: left;"| Left Aligned +! style="text-align: right;"| Right Aligned +! style="text-align: left;"| Default aligned +|- +| style="text-align: center;"| First +| style="text-align: left;"| row +| style="text-align: right;"| 12.0 +| style="text-align: left;"| Example of a row that spans multiple lines. +|- +| style="text-align: center;"| Second +| style="text-align: left;"| row +| style="text-align: right;"| 5.0 +| style="text-align: left;"| Here’s another one. Note the blank line between rows. |} Multiline table without caption: -{| -!align="center" width="15%"| Centered Header -!width="13%"| Left Aligned -!align="right" width="16%"| Right Aligned -!width="35%"| Default aligned -|- -|align="center"| First -| row -|align="right"| 12.0 -| Example of a row that spans multiple lines. -|- -|align="center"| Second -| row -|align="right"| 5.0 -| Here’s another one. Note the blank line between rows. +{| class="wikitable" +|- +! style="text-align: center;"| Centered Header +! style="text-align: left;"| Left Aligned +! style="text-align: right;"| Right Aligned +! style="text-align: left;"| Default aligned +|- +| style="text-align: center;"| First +| style="text-align: left;"| row +| style="text-align: right;"| 12.0 +| style="text-align: left;"| Example of a row that spans multiple lines. +|- +| style="text-align: center;"| Second +| style="text-align: left;"| row +| style="text-align: right;"| 5.0 +| style="text-align: left;"| Here’s another one. Note the blank line between rows. |} Table without column headers: -{| -|align="right"| 12 -| 12 -|align="center"| 12 -|align="right"| 12 -|- -|align="right"| 123 -| 123 -|align="center"| 123 -|align="right"| 123 -|- -|align="right"| 1 -| 1 -|align="center"| 1 -|align="right"| 1 +{| class="wikitable" +|- +| style="text-align: right;"| 12 +| style="text-align: left;"| 12 +| style="text-align: center;"| 12 +| style="text-align: right;"| 12 +|- +| style="text-align: right;"| 123 +| style="text-align: left;"| 123 +| style="text-align: center;"| 123 +| style="text-align: right;"| 123 +|- +| style="text-align: right;"| 1 +| style="text-align: left;"| 1 +| style="text-align: center;"| 1 +| style="text-align: right;"| 1 |} Multiline table without column headers: -{| -|align="center" width="15%"| First -|width="13%"| row -|align="right" width="16%"| 12.0 -|width="35%"| Example of a row that spans multiple lines. -|- -|align="center"| Second -| row -|align="right"| 5.0 +{| class="wikitable" +|- +| style="text-align: center;"| First +| style="text-align: left;"| row +| style="text-align: right;"| 12.0 +| Example of a row that spans multiple lines. +|- +| style="text-align: center;"| Second +| style="text-align: left;"| row +| style="text-align: right;"| 5.0 | Here’s another one. Note the blank line between rows. |} |
